What is Project Ztopia APK?

Picture this: the world’s gone topsy-turvy after a zombie outbreak, and you’re not just surviving – you’re ruling. Project Ztopia APK is a gripping post-apocalyptic survival RPG that blends strategy, action, and a dash of empire-building flair. Developed by SiGames, this Android gem lets you step into the shoes of a cunning leader (think benevolent tyrant with a soft spot for aesthetics) tasked with rebuilding society from the ashes.

At its core, the game drops you into a ravaged landscape teeming with the undead. Your mission? Scavenge resources, construct unbreakable shelters, and assemble a loyal crew of survivors – including some eye-catching companions that add a unique twist to the harem collection mechanic. Now, user tips from my trial-and-error scars – these’ll boost your survival rate by 50%, easy.

  1. Early Game Grind Smart: Focus on farms over defenses first. Starving survivors = mutiny. Stockpile Z-Crystals from daily quests; they’re gold for hero upgrades.
  2. Harem Synergy Hacks: Pair scouts with builders for 20% faster resource hauls. Romance events? Trigger them during full moons for bonus loyalty – game-changer for mid-game pushes.
  3. Zombie Wave Counters: Use decoy flares against hordes; saves ammo. For bosses, kite with ranged units while melee flanks. Pro move: Upgrade traps pre-nightfall.
  4. Base Layout Wisdom: Cluster farms centrally, walls in layers. Relatable example: My first base got overrun because I skimped on gates – lesson learned, now it’s a fortress.
  5. Battery & Storage Savers: Lower graphics to medium for longer sessions. Clear cache weekly to avoid lags.
  6. Alliance Etiquette: Trade fairly; hoarding invites raids. My crew’s pact: Share blueprints, split loot 60/40.
  7. Offline Optimization: Queue builds before bed – wake to progress. Sync progress via Google Play for cross-device magic.
